Start with the roofing system, not the panels
A great deal of sales discussions start with panel brand names. That is reasonable, since modules are visible and easy to contrast. But seasoned home owners and professionals know the roof needs to come first.
Before you even compare installers, ask a simple concern: is your roof covering an excellent candidate today? If the roofing system has only a few years of life left, solar might still make sense, however you should analyze reroofing prior to installment. Eliminating and reinstalling panels later includes price, and not every company takes care of that procedure well. A solid installer will certainly elevate this concern early, even if it slows down the sale.
The very same relates to shading. A mature tree on the south or west side of a residential or commercial property can drastically alter outcome over the course of a year. In Chico communities with older landscape design, that is not a minor information. Excellent installers make use of color analysis tools and describe exactly how early morning shade differs from late afternoon shade, just how seasonal sunlight angles impact manufacturing, and whether cutting is rewarding. Weak ones offer you a manufacturing estimate that assumes cleaner sunlight direct exposure than your roofing in fact gets.
Roof pitch, alignment, attic room ventilation, and the condition of the electric panel all matter too. If a salesperson winds past those details and moves right to funding, that is an indicator to slow down down.
The ideal installer is usually the most effective job manager
Homeowners typically think about a solar firm as a building crew. It is more exact to think of it as a project manager that likewise does building and construction. A household solar job touches style, structural testimonial, electrical engineering, utility coordination, local allowing, procurement, scheduling, inspections, and final commissioning.
That is why 2 firms utilizing comparable tools can supply really various experiences.
One business might send plans promptly, address city comments rapidly, and connect schedule modifications prior to you need to ask. An additional may leave you questioning for weeks whether licenses were submitted at all. The panels on the roofing may look similar in a picture, but the second project prices a lot more in tension and delay.
Ask who deals with each phase. Some firms market the project and then hand it off to subcontractors you never meet until setup day. Subcontracting is not immediately negative, yet it does require more scrutiny. You require to understand who is liable if the roofing system flashes leakage, if conduit runs look untidy, or if the tracking app never ever gets set up correctly.
The toughest solar installers Chico has have a tendency to be extremely clear about this chain of duty. They can tell you that makes the system, that installs it, that draws licenses, and that handles post-install solution. Vagueness right here typically becomes migraines later.

What to ask when you compare proposals
Most proposals look polished. They reveal rows of sleek panels, a forecasted savings number, and a monthly repayment that appears workable. The trouble is that numerous homeowners contrast the wrong points. A quote is not simply a price. It is a package of assumptions.
The fastest way to inform whether you are handling a significant expert is to ask particular concerns and see exactly how they respond.
- What presumptions are you using for yearly usage, energy rate escalation, and system degradation?
- Who does the installation work, your employees or subcontractors?
- What equipment is included, to inverter design, racking system, and keeping track of platform?
- What is covered under craftsmanship warranty, and that manages service phone calls after installation?
- If my roofing requires work, panel removal, or electric upgrades, how are those prices handled?
Good firms welcome these inquiries. They answer directly and in simple language. Weaker ones pivot back to monthly settlement, tax obligation rewards, or a limited-time offer.
Pay very close attention to production quotes. Two installers might recommend systems of comparable size yet anticipate notably various outcome. That space does not always mean one company is existing, but it does indicate someone is utilizing various presumptions about shielding, azimuth, tilt, or regional climate data. Ask them to clarify the difference. The way they explain it tells you a lot.
Pricing is important, however cheap solar can obtain expensive
Price per watt works, but it is not the entire story. A lower price may reflect lean procedures and reasonable margins, or it may mirror hurried style, low-quality labor, inadequate solution capacity, or devices choices that are hard to sustain later.
I have seen house owners fixate on a quote that came in a number of thousand bucks below rivals, just to find later that the contract omitted a primary panel upgrade, did not account for roof repairs around mounting factors, or utilized a system layout that pushed panels into partial shade to strike a larger advertised dimension. The preliminary savings disappeared quickly.
The contrary mistake happens as well. A high quote is not proof of high quality. Some business cost high because they can, not because they provide much better engineering or assistance. The objective is not to discover the most affordable or most costly installer. It is to recognize why the cost is what it is.
For residential solar, it aids to compare the complete mounted price, the approximated annual manufacturing, the warranty terms, and the scope of consisted of work. If one quote is significantly lower, ask what has actually been omitted. If one is substantially greater, ask what warrants the premium.
A valuable gut check is whether the proposition really feels engineered or just sold. An engineered proposition specifies, constrained by your genuine roofing system and usage profile, and honest about compromises. A sales-driven proposal tends to be smoother, much less comprehensive, and a lot more focused on seriousness than fit.
Warranties just matter if the business can honor them
Many property owners listen to "25-year guarantee" and presume they are fully secured. Solar warranties are a lot more complex than that.
Panel manufacturers usually offer item and performance service warranties. Inverter business provide their own coverage, frequently with different terms. The installer might also supply a handiwork warranty that covers roofing system penetrations, installing, wiring, and installation-related problems. These are separate defenses, and they are only as useful as the companies supporting them.
When you assess guarantee language, seek clarity on labor, not just parts. A failed part under producer service warranty is less comforting if you still have to pay for diagnostic sees, roof accessibility, delivery, or reinstallation labor. Ask who functions as your advocate if a component fails. The installer should not just state, "Call the supplier." They ought to explain their service process.
Longevity matters too. A more recent company might still do excellent work, but you must ask how service commitments are handled if ownership modifications or the business quits operating. Pay focus to the electric details
Solar sales discussions frequently show panels and cost savings charts. Much of the quality distinctions, nevertheless, are concealed in electrical work you may never see unless something goes wrong.
Look at exactly how the installer talks about channel positioning, roofing penetrations, labeling, disconnect locations, and panel assimilation. Tidy job is not just cosmetic. It normally shows technique. A staff that takes pride abreast, weather condition securing, and clean wiring is commonly a staff that adheres to procedure in less visible locations too.
Your major circuit box is entitled to special interest. Older homes in Chico may require upgrades, derating, or load-side link planning to suit solar safely and lawfully. If battery storage space becomes part of the layout, affiliation comes to be much more included. You want an installer who can explain this clearly, not one that treats your panel as an afterthought.
There is also a real distinction between business that merely set up to minimum code and business that think ahead. The far better ones intend service into the system. They prevent developing roof covering layouts that make complex future upkeep, and they put tools where professionals can actually access it later without turning regular solution into a half-day ordeal.

Financing changes the economics greater than the equipment in some cases does
A house owner paying cash and a property owner financing through a long-term loan can evaluate the same system very differently. Interest rate, dealership charges, lending term, and prepayment framework all form the genuine price of going solar.
This is where numerous otherwise smart purchasers obtain tripped up. They contrast monthly repayments rather than complete project cost. That can make an expensive funding bundle appearance attractive because the repayment is stretched out. A professional installer should agree to talk about cash money rate, funded price, and how various funding frameworks influence long-term savings.
Lease and power acquisition setups may likewise go into the photo. For some families, they provide a lower obstacle to entry. For others, they make complex home resale and minimize the economic upside compared to ownership. There is nobody right solution, however there need to be an honest conversation. If a salesperson prevents total-cost math and keeps steering every little thing back to "lower than your current utility expense," proceed carefully.

Beware of large promises
Solar can reduce electrical bills greatly. In some families, it can almost offset yearly usage. That does not indicate every roof supports a "absolutely no expense" outcome, and any kind of installer who ensures that outcome without careful energy analysis is overselling.
Usage patterns issue. If you warm with power, bill an EV, run a swimming pool pump, or anticipate family need to rise, your excellent system may look very different from your next-door neighbor's. The best installers account for future changes. If you tell them an EV is likely within two years, they ought to go over whether to dimension for that currently, leave area for growth, or set solar with effectiveness enhancements first.
A sensible firm additionally explains the limitations of web metering or whatever settlement framework applies in your utility area at the time of installation. Exported electricity and on-site consumption are not always valued the same way. That impacts repayment and battery worth. Straight talk right here is a good sign.
A short list of red flags
Some warning signs show up so constantly that they should have special attention.
- The sales representative stress you to authorize the same day to safeguard a going away incentive.
- The proposition does not have specific equipment information or utilizes vague language like "or equivalent."
- The company can not clearly describe who handles licenses, setup, and service warranty service.
- Savings estimates rely on hostile utility inflation presumptions without disclosure.
- Questions about roof covering problem, shielding, or panel upgrades are combed aside.
None of these factors alone verifies a company is unqualified, but with each other they commonly signal a sales-first operation.

What are the disadvantages of solar panels in Chico?
Solar panels require a significant upfront investment and may not be suitable for every roof. Energy production decreases during cloudy weather and stops at night without battery storage. Roof repairs may require temporary panel removal. Equipment such as inverters may need replacement before the panels reach the end of their lifespan.

What is the average lifespan of solar panels in Chico?
Most solar panels have an average lifespan of 25 to 30 years. Their electricity production gradually declines over time, but they often continue operating beyond the warranty period. Routine maintenance can help maintain efficiency throughout their lifespan. Inverters typically require replacement after about 10 to 15 years.
